The 5267 postcode area, including Wirrega, Brimbago, Coombe, Keith, Laffer, Makin, Mccallum, Mount Charles, Petherick, Shaugh, Sherwood and Willalooka, is home to 706 vehicles. Among these, 13 are electric cars, which include battery electric vehicles (BEVs), plug-in hybrid electric vehicles (PHEVs), hybrid vehicles, and fuel cell electric vehicles (FCEVs). This means that2% of the region’s vehicles are now electric, highlighting a growing shift towards sustainable transportation.
Assuming each vehile travels an average of 10,000km per year, the ICE (Internal Combustion Engine) vehicles in Wirrega, Brimbago, Coombe, Keith, Laffer, Makin, Mccallum, Mount Charles, Petherick, Shaugh, Sherwood and Willalooka are emitting approximately 2502 tonnes of CO2 per year.

Collectively, electric vehicles (EVs) can be charged using solar energy. Based on sunshine data from the nearest weather station, Taunton, a typical household with a 6 kW solar power system can charge an EV to travel up to 229 km per day during the summer month of January, and 65 km per day in July, with an annual average of 141 km per day.

Wirrega EV Demographics
With a population of 1768 people, Wirrega has 706 motor vehicles based on the Australian Bureau Of Statistics 2021 Census. This is made up of 208 homes with 1 motor vehicle, 284 homes with 2 motor vehicles, and 214 of homes with 3 motor vehicles or more.
With 4 public ev charging stations in Wirrega and a combined 13 registered vehicles that are either battery electric vehicles (BEVs), plug-in hybrid electric vehicles (PHEVs), hybrid vehicles, there’s a growing interest in electric cars and Wirrega electric car charging stations. For the 491 homes that already have solar panels in the 5267 postcode, being 56% of the total 872 homes in this community, Wirrega EV owners who combine home solar panels with an EV charger with benefit financially whilst also reducing their environmental impact.

Charging Networks & Compatibility Wirrega’s charging infrastructure connects to major networks like Chargefox and Evie Networks, offering seamless access for most EV models. The popular Hyundai Ioniq 6 and MG MG4 utilise CCS2 connectors for rapid charging, while the Mercedes-Benz eVito Tourer and Mazda CX-60 PHEV typically use Type 2 ports. With CHAdeMO compatibility available at select stations, even drivers of older EVs stay covered. Solar-Powered Charging: Wirrega’s Bright Advantage Boasting 17MJ/m²/day of solar radiation (about 4.7kW/m²/day), Wirrega’s climate makes solar charging exceptionally practical. A typical 6.6kW solar system here can generate 30kWh daily – enough to fully charge a Hyundai Ioniq 6 (14.3kWh/100km) for over 200km of emissions-free driving. For the average local commute, this translates to near-zero charging costs after system installation. Even the Mercedes eVito Tourer’s larger 26.2kWh/100km consumption becomes manageable with solar, slashing fuel costs by up to 80% compared to petrol.
